Flavorful Dressings to Elevate Your Salad

The Importance of Dressing

Of course, no salad would ever be complete without some flavor dressing to tie it all together. As much as store-bought dressings are convenient, they tend to be filled with added sugars, preservatives, and unhealthy fats. Why not make your own? It's easy, inexpensive, and you control the quality and amount of the ingredients. With just a few easy ingredients, you can dress up a delicious salad flavor that does not overpower or overwhelm the natural flavors you want to highlight.

Here are some homemade dressing recipes for you to try on your salads:

Tangy Vinaigrette

Creamy Tahini Dressing

End. For a simple vinaigrette, combine olive oil, balsamic vinegar, Dijon mustard, garlic, and honey. Or, for a non-dairy version, combine tahini, lemon juice, garlic, and water until it's smooth and creamy. Some Delicious Salad Combinations

Salads Inspired by the Mediterranean Region

Transport your taste buds to the sunny shores of the Mediterranean with a refreshing Greek salad. Crunchy cucumbers, juicy tomatoes, tangy olives, creamy feta cheese, and crunchy red onions make an appearance in this perfect flavor burst in every single bite. A simple ol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, and oregano dressing ties it all together. Serve with warm pita bread for a complete meal that will fill you up and leave you feeling satisfied.

Asian-Style Delights

In case you want a fusion of flavors that will absolutely amaze you, take a Vietnamese-inspired rice noodle salad. Combine these cooked rice noodles with crunch vegetables, fresh herbs, and savory tofu or tempeh in a meal that is as lovely to look at as it's delicious. Top it all off with a zesty lime juice, soy sauce, sesame oil, ginger, and chili flakes dressing that will give you a lot of flavor. Topping it with crushed peanuts and cilantro will only give it a crunchy crust but also a nice rush of freshness. Therefore, for warm weather eating, this salad is revitalizing and refreshing.
